Average number of rat burrows falls 40% in early 2026: NEA
The average number of rat burrows recorded per two-month surveillance cycle in Singapore dropped to about 2,900 in early 2026, down from about 4,900 in 2025.

EU hosts Taliban for migrant return talks in Brussels
The EU is hosting Taliban officials after Belgium granted temporary visas for talks on returning failed Afghan asylum-seekers. The meeting is one of the bloc’s highest-level contacts with the Taliban since 2021.

Europe on red alert for record-breaking heat
Dozens of people have drowned in France and Germany in recent days as people seek relief from “oppressive” heat. In Italy, more than a dozen cities are on high alert for extreme heat. DW has the latest.
